当前位置: 代码网 >

it编程

Mysql锁机制,行锁表锁的使用详解

Mysql锁机制,行锁表锁的使用详解

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 4

锁是计算机协调多个线程访问同一个系统资源的机制锁的分类:从数据的操作类型分为:读锁和写锁从数据的操作粒度分为:行锁和表锁表锁偏读,myisa...

MySQL账号权限管理指南(创建账户与授权)

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 2

一、为何需要创建独立账号?最小权限原则:每个用户只拥有完成工作所必需的权限,避免因账号泄露导致整个数据库沦陷操作审计需求:不同账号的操作日志...

MySQL 慢查询日志、日志分析工具mysqldumpslow示例详解

MySQL 慢查询日志、日志分析工具mysqldumpslow示例详解

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 0

mysqldumpslow 常用参数:-s,是order的顺序----- al 平均锁定时间-----ar 平均返回记录时间-----at ...

mysql慢查询mysqldumpslow的使用详解

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 1

简言1. mysql中的慢查询是我们分析问题,定位问题的利器,巧妙使用可以快速解决问题2. 原理:运行时间超过 long_query_tim...

Redis统计访问量的3种实现方式

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 1

一、你是否遇到过这些统计难题?高并发场景下内存爆炸:用hash统计日活时,单键内存占用飙升到10mb?独立访客重复计数:用户多次访问被重复统...

MySQL CTE 通用表达式详解

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 1

在mysql中,cte(common table expressions,通用表表达式)是一种简洁而强大的语法,用于构建临时的结果集,通常用...

Redis定时监控与数据处理的实践指南

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 1

1. 背景与需求分析1.1 原始需求我们有一个logmediaadidcache类,用于缓存广告位 id,并定期从 redis 刷新数据。原...

MySQL 安装与使用步骤详解

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 2

mysql 安装与使用一、安装步骤 (windows)访问官网下载页面进入社区版下载页:mysql community server选择操作...

在Oracle中创建不同类型索引的SQL语法和示例

2025-06-10 11:58 | 分类:数据库 | 评论:0 次 | 浏览: 3

在oracle中,添加索引是优化查询性能的重要手段。以下是创建不同类型索引的 sql 语法和示例:一、基本索引创建语法1. 单列索引crea...

Java的内存泄漏和性能瓶颈解读

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 3

内存泄漏‌内存泄漏‌指的是程序中已分配的内存由于某种原因无法被释放或回收,导致内存的浪费和潜在的程序崩溃。在java中,...

如何在Java中使用org.json和JSON-B解析与编写JSON

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 2

前言json(javascript object notation)因其轻量、语言无关且易于读写的特性,已成为现代 web 应用中数据交换的...

SpringCloudGateway 自定义局部过滤器场景分析

SpringCloudGateway 自定义局部过滤器场景分析

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 2

场景:将所有请求转化为同一路径请求(方便穿网配置)在请求头内标识原来路径,然后在将请求分发给不同服务alltoonegatewayfilte...

Java IO流必备之File、递归与字符集举例详解

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 2

filefile是java.io.包下的类,file类的对象,用于代表当前操作系统的文件(可以是文件、或文件夹)。file类的对象可以代表文...

c/c++中opencv双边滤波的实现

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 0

双边滤波器(bilateral filter)是一种非线性的图像平滑技术,它能够在有效去除噪声的同时,较好地保留图像的边缘信息。这使其在许多...

C语言 fgetc的用法详解以注意事项场景分析

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 2

fgetc是 c 语言标准库中用于从文件流读取单个字符的函数,其原型为:int fgetc(file *stream);一、常见使用场景1....

Java使用Spring AI的10个实用技巧分享

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 1

引言在当今的软件开发领域,人工智能的集成已经成为提升应用功能和用户体验的重要手段。对于 java 开发者而言,spring ai 提供了一套...

java并发中的同步器使用方式

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 2

同步器java 并发包中的同步器是一些用于协调多个线程执行的工具,用于实现线程之间的同步和互斥操作。这些同步器提供了不同的机制来控制线程的访...

Java中的内存模型(JMM)和锁机制详解

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 1

java内存模型(java memory model, jmm)是java虚拟机(jvm)规范中定义的一种内存模型(抽象概念),它描述了ja...

Java中的try-catch块和异常捕获方式

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 2

今天来聊一聊关于java 中的try-catch块和异常捕获一、try-catch块的基本结构try-catch块是java异常处理的核心结...

Java死锁问题解决方案及示例详解

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 2

1、简述死锁(deadlock)是指两个或多个线程因争夺资源而相互等待,导致所有线程都无法继续执行的一种状态。死锁的四个必要条件:互斥条件:...

SpringBoot 中 CommandLineRunner的作用示例详解

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 3

1、commandlinerunnerspringboot中commandlinerunner的作用平常开发中有可能需要实现在项目启动后执行...

浅析Python如何利用算法进行性能优化

2025-06-10 11:58 | 分类:前端脚本 | 评论:0 次 | 浏览: 1

在python开发中,算法优化是提升程序性能的关键手段。尽管python以其简洁易读的语法著称,但在处理大规模数据或高并发场景时,算法效率的...

Python虚拟环境管理工具Conda的使用指南

2025-06-10 11:58 | 分类:前端脚本 | 评论:0 次 | 浏览: 1

在python开发中,虚拟环境是管理项目依赖的核心工具。通过虚拟环境,开发者可以隔离不同项目的依赖包和python版本,避免因版本冲突导致的...

Python Fastapi实现统一处理各种异常

2025-06-10 11:58 | 分类:前端脚本 | 评论:0 次 | 浏览: 2

在 fastapi 中处理参数校验错误(通常由 pydantic 模型或路径参数校验触发)需要使用自定义异常处理器捕获 requestval...

Python新手入门指南之如何极速搭建开发环境

Python新手入门指南之如何极速搭建开发环境

2025-06-10 11:58 | 分类:前端脚本 | 评论:0 次 | 浏览: 1

引言python在软件开发领域占据重要地位,广泛应用于web开发、数据分析、人工智能及自动化脚本等领域。其简洁的语法和丰富的库支持使其成为开...

Python使用smtplib库开发一个邮件自动发送工具

Python使用smtplib库开发一个邮件自动发送工具

2025-06-10 11:58 | 分类:前端脚本 | 评论:0 次 | 浏览: 1

代码实现与知识点解析1. 导入必要的库# 导入tkinter模块,用于创建图形界面import tkinter as tk# 导入ttk模块...

S3 标签字符清洗的正则表达式实践记录

2025-06-10 11:58 | 分类:编程语言 | 评论:0 次 | 浏览: 1

深入理解 s3 标签字符清洗的正则表达式实践在构建与 aws s3 相关的服务时,尤其是使用 s3 标签(tag)作为资源标识或元数据时,确...

CnPlugin是PL/SQL Developer工具插件使用教程

CnPlugin是PL/SQL Developer工具插件使用教程

2025-06-09 19:13 | 分类:数据库 | 评论:0 次 | 浏览: 5

pl/sql developer工具插件使用cnplugin是pl/sql developer工具插件,支持pl/sql developer...

MySQL复杂SQL之多表联查/子查询详细介绍(最新整理)

2025-06-09 19:13 | 分类:数据库 | 评论:0 次 | 浏览: 3

mysql 中复杂 sql 的核心部分:多表联查和子查询。这是数据库操作中处理关联数据的强大工具。核心目标: 从多个相互关联的表中组合和提取...

Java中常见队列举例详解(非线程安全)

Java中常见队列举例详解(非线程安全)

2025-06-09 19:13 | 分类:编程语言 | 评论:0 次 | 浏览: 5

一.队列定义在 java 中,队列(queue)是一种遵循先进先出(fifo)原则的数据结构,可以通过java.util.queue接口及其...

Copyright © 2017-2025  代码网 保留所有权利. 粤ICP备2024248653号
站长QQ:2386932994 | 联系邮箱:2386932994@qq.com